Understanding Transit Systems

Transit systems play a pivotal role in the efficient movement of individuals and resources within urban environments. They provide a crucial means of connecting communities, reducing congestion, and fostering economic prosperity. Examples of transit systems include buses, trains, and subways, among others.

Importance of Efficient Transit Networks

Well-developed transit networks offer a multitude of benefits for cities and their inhabitants. They:

  • Enhance Connectivity: Transit systems bridge distances, enabling seamless movement of people and goods within an urban area. They connect residential neighborhoods to employment hubs, shopping centers, and recreational facilities.
  • Reduce Congestion: By providing an alternative to private vehicles, transit systems alleviate traffic congestion and improve air quality. They reduce the number of cars on the road, freeing up space for other forms of transportation.
  • Foster Economic Prosperity: Efficient transit networks enhance the productivity of a city’s workforce. They allow employees to reach their workplaces quickly and reliably, reducing absenteeism and increasing efficiency. They also attract businesses and investment to areas with robust transit infrastructure.

Examples of Transit Systems

Transit systems come in various forms, each serving specific purposes and benefiting different segments of the population. Common examples include:

  • Buses: Flexible and cost-effective, buses provide a convenient mode of transportation for short and medium distances. They are particularly useful in areas with low population density or limited infrastructure.
  • Trains: Trains offer high-speed and capacity for longer distances. They are ideal for connecting suburbs and cities, reducing commuting times and congestion.
  • Subways: Underground or elevated trains are used in densely populated areas to avoid traffic congestion on the surface. They provide reliable and fast transit, especially during peak hours.

In conclusion, transit systems are essential infrastructure for modern cities. They facilitate connectivity, reduce congestion, and boost economic growth. Effective transit networks enhance the quality of life for residents and contribute significantly to the overall success and sustainability of urban environments.
